What is this tool?
A Reading Time Calculator estimates how long a piece of text takes to read silently and to speak aloud. It divides the word count by a reading speed in words per minute (WPM) that you choose — 200, 238, or 300 WPM — and shows the result in minutes and seconds, alongside a separate speaking-time estimate at a slower spoken pace for presentations, videos, and podcasts. It also shows the word and character counts. The numbers are estimates; actual time varies by reader, speaker, and content difficulty.
